Undertale No Hit has finally been completed. Each individual encounter, excluding scripted damage (obviously), has finally been done completely damageless, 4½ years after the game came out.

This took maybe around 40-50 hours, I didn't keep track and I have no way of knowing exactly since I have my Undertale disconnected from steam.
But yeah, this is No Hit Asriel, first and second phase, the full fight, done in a single segment for those who don't get it. This has never been done before up until this point.

The main reason this hasn't been done before is probably obvious, that second to last attack where he just goes crazy and spams an absurd amount of missiles. Most would write this attack off as impossible to no hit. Well as it turns out, that's true only about 97% of the time! :smileW: (my rough estimate based on my consistency)
That isn't to say there's no skill involved in dodging the attack, you still have to have the reading ability and familiarity with the dodging methods in order to evade this attack at all. Of course there's like a .5% chance you'll get a completely free pattern, but those are way worse odds to work with. So, I learned of a way you can use a savestate to practice just that attack, or just the second phase, repeatedly in isolation. That helped me a LOT, I may not have attempted this otherwise, or at least this would have taken way longer ( so thanks, Depa c: ).
